Abstract
Even though the hardware complexity is reduced and precision is increased in the DDFS, the obtained signal is in no match with the ideal signal. This is because of the non-linearity of DACs present in the DDFS architecture. The conventional DDFS architecture doesn't account for the non-linearity of DAC which deteriorates the quality of the signal. This reduces the SNR and SFDR of the signal. This error can be reduced by the optimizing the values using Genetic algorithm.
